• Créer un serveur de stockage cloud sur Rasberry Pi
  • Créer un serveur de stockage cloud sur Rasberry Pi 2
  • Créer un serveur de stockage cloud sur Rasberry Pi 3

Rasberry Pi est un nano-ordinateur monocarte doté d’un processeur ARM. Son objectif est simple : permettre d’apprendre la programmation informatique à moindre coût. Vous voulez mettre en place la sauvegarde et le partage de fichiers sur votre Rasberry Pi dans un cloud gratuit, personnel et en toute sécurité ? Il est tout à fait possible de s’affranchir de solutions comme Dropbox ou Google Drive : nous vous recommandons l’installation de Owncloud, que nous avons déjà évoqué dans un précédent article. Cette solution open source vous permettra très simplement de créer un espace de stockage en ligne permettant la sauvegarde automatique de toutes vos données.

Aujourd’hui, nous vous proposons un tutoriel pour installer en quelques étapes à peine un serveur de stockage cloud sur Rasberry Pi :

Quel matériel pour sauvegarder mes données dans le nuage avec un Rasberry Pi ?

Lorsqu’un internaute visite une page web, il en comprend rapidement la signification. Cependant, ce n’est pas aussi facile que cela pour les robots : leur compréhension de la page est beaucoup plus limitée. Les données structurées de Schema.org permettent de rendre les contenus des pages beaucoup plus compréhensibles pour les moteurs de recherche. Ainsi, les moteurs de recherche peuvent maintenant comprendre si une page a pour objet une entreprise, un livre, un film ou même une personne.

Comment mettre en place une structuration sémantique sur ses pages HTML ?

Nous vous conseillons d’avoir à votre disposition :

  • Votre Rasberry
  • Une alimentation
  • Une carte micro SD d’un minimum de 32 GO pour le stockage

A savoir qu’il vous sera possible par la suite d’ajouter un disque dur externe avec plus de mémoire afin de sauvegarder toutes vos données.

  • Un câble RJ45 ou un dongle USB pour connecter votre appareil à Internet

Installer owncloud sur Rasberry Pi

Voici les différentes étapes à suivre afin d’installer et de configurer un cloud sur le Rasberry Pi :

Commencez par modifier les paramètres du raspi-config en utilisant la commande :

  • sudo raspi-config
  • Dans le menu, allez dans les options avancées puis dans memory_split. Modifiez la valeur indiquée par 16.

  • Dans le menu Overclock, choisissez un réglage à 900MHz pour Medium.
  • Redémarrez votre Rasberry Pi.
  • Mettez à jour les paquets avec les commandes :
  • sudo apt-get update
  • sudo apt-get upgrade
  • Précisez le paramétrage utilisateur :
  • sudo usermod -a -G www-data www-data
  • Installez ensuite les paquets indispensables pour l’installation d’Owncloud :
  • sudo apt-get install apache2 php5 php5-gd php5-sqlite php5-curl php5-json php5-
  • common php5-intl php-pear php-apc php-xml- parser libapache2-mod- php5 curl
  • libcurl3 libcurl3-dev sqlite
  • Allez à la fin du fichier apache2.cong et ajoutez la ligne suivante :
  • ServerName owncloud
  • Dans le fichier de l’host, modifiez le nom de ce dernier à la dernière ligne en remplaçant
  • “Rasberry Pi” par “Owncloud”
  • Dans le fichier suivant (/etc/apache2/sites-enabled/000- default), modifiez l’indication
  • “AllowOverride None” par “AllowOverride All”
  • Dans le fichier php.ini, changez la limite d’upload de la façon suivante :
  • upload_max_filesize = 2G
  • post_max_size = 2G
  • Supprimez index.html (attention, il doit s’agir de l’ancien fichier) :
  • sudo rm /var/www/index.html
  • Activez la réécriture Apache :
  • sudo a2enmod rewrite
  • sudo a2enmod headers
  • Redémarrez Apache :
  • sudo /etc/init.d/apache2 restart
  • Une fois le redémarrage terminé, téléchargez owncloud :
  • cd
  • wget http://download.owncloud.org/community/owncloud-5.0.0.tar.bz2
  • Vous devrez ensuite extraire l’archive :
  • tar xvf owncloud-5.0.0.tar.bz2
  • Déplacez le dossier vers /var/www en utilisant les commandes suivantes :
  • sudo mv owncloud/* /var/www
  • sudo mv owncloud/.htaccess /var/www
  • Il ne vous reste plus qu’à supprimer l’archive puis à paramétrer les droits de l’utilisateur :
  • rm -rf owncloud owncloud-5.0.0.tar.bz2 sudo chown -R www-data:www- data /var/www
  • Et c’est fini, vous pouvez maintenant vous connecter à Owncloud avec votre Rasberry Pi :
  • vos données seront sauvegardées dans un nuage sûr, performant et open source !